Sudden cardiac death syndrome and pump dysfunction: the link.

Summary
Sudden cardiac death in heart failure patients is linked to system disturbances. Aggressively treating heart failure, particularly with vasodilators and ACE inhibitors, is key, rather than routine antiarrhythmic drugs.
Area of Science:
- Cardiology
- Heart Failure Management
- Sudden Cardiac Death Prevention
Background:
- Sudden cardiac death (SCD) in heart failure (HF) is associated with neurohumoral, hemodynamic, and mechanical system perturbations.
- Standard antiarrhythmic drug therapy lacks proven benefit in unselected HF patients without significant symptomatic ventricular arrhythmias.
Purpose of the Study:
- To evaluate the efficacy of aggressive heart failure management versus routine antiarrhythmic drugs for preventing SCD.
- To determine appropriate treatment strategies for ventricular arrhythmias in heart failure.
Main Methods:
- Review of current guidelines and evidence regarding HF management and arrhythmia treatment.
- Analysis of the role of vasodilators and angiotensin-converting enzyme (ACE) inhibitors in managing HF and associated arrhythmias.
- Consideration of interventions for bradyarrhythmias and tachyarrhythmias.
Main Results:
- Aggressive treatment of the heart failure syndrome is paramount.
- Systemic vascular unloading with vasodilators and ACE inhibitors may help prevent arrhythmias triggered by ventricular stretch and wall stress.
- Pharmacologic treatment of asymptomatic ventricular arrhythmias is generally not recommended; focus should be on symptomatic ventricular tachycardia or syncope.
Conclusions:
- Effective management of congestive heart failure often resolves life-threatening arrhythmias.
- Appropriate use of vasodilators and ACE inhibitors is crucial for improving outcomes and reducing mortality.
- Pacemaker insertion or atrioventricular nodal ablation may be considered for specific bradyarrhythmia or asystole-related SCD prevention.
